  • Q: How to Maintain and Fix the Cruise Control Switch on Chrysler LHS?
    A:
    Remove the negative cable from the battery and turn the ignition off to service or fix the cruise control switch. The clock spring device controlled by the speed control switch is placed under the Air Bag module in the Steering Wheel. Should the air bag module need removal, engage in the proper safety steps as advised by your vehicle's manual. After that, take out the side screws on the switch and carefully jiggle it to unplug the connector from the air bag and steering wheel. Use the same steps to configure the other switch, also. To install, join the two-way electrical connector, install the switch and fasten it with the two screws. After that, attach the negative Battery Cable again.
